Many casino operators already invest in radio. New in-car listening data now creates a way to measure and improve the impact of those dollars. Connected vehicle platforms allow broadcasters to see where audiences travel while they are tuned in, tying listening behavior to real-world movement patterns. A recent Inside Radio article explains how this technology is giving broadcasters new visibility into geographic listening behavior in near real time. (Inside Radio Article)
For casinos, this is a measurement breakthrough because now we can connect exposure to proximity, visitation patterns, and real-world behavior. That is where media stops being awareness and starts becoming performance.
Radio Can Now Prove Listeners Pass Your Casino
Historically, radio could tell us who listened most and when. It could not tell us who drove past a casino on the way to work while hearing a promotional spot.
Connected car platforms now provide heat maps showing where tuned-in vehicles travel throughout the day. (Inside Radio Article)

Radio Is Becoming a Visitation Measurement Channel
The next phase of this technology will allow isolation of vehicles exposed to radio campaigns and analysis of whether those vehicles later visited advertiser locations. (Inside Radio Article)
For casinos, that is a major shift.

In-Car Visual Sync Increases Ad Impact
The article also highlights how synchronized visual messaging inside vehicles can reinforce radio ads and improve brand recall and purchase intent. (Inside Radio Article)
This transforms radio from audio-only into a coordinated audio and visual experience.
